Mwanaulu Issa Mwajita is the Director, Trade Facilitation and Policy Harmonization for the Intergovernmental Standing Committee on Shipping (ISCOS) Secretariat. Her leadership roles include serving as a Board Member for the World Maritime University Women’s Association, Secretary to the Mentorship Committee of WOMESA Kenya and Chairperson of the Technical Committee on Shipping, Ports and Logistics for the Association of Maritime Professionals Kenya (AMPK).


She brings to the table a wealth of experience spanning over 15 years in the Port and Shipping Sector specializing in maritime sector system automation projects for Shipping, Port, Trade and Logistics stakeholders with a key specialization in Single Window Systems and trade facilitation.
Previously she worked for the Kenya Trade Network Agency (KenTrade) as a Principal Business Analyst where she conceptualized and spearheaded the delivery of the Maritime Single Window Project for Kenya’s maritime stakeholders.


She holds an MSc Degree in Maritime Affairs specializing in Shipping Management & Logistics from the World Maritime University (WMU), Sweden, MSc Degree in Information Systems (Lund University, Sweden), and a BSc Degree in Computer Science (Kampala International University, Uganda). Mwanaulu is certified in PRINCE2 project management and is a member of the Nautical Institute (MNI) and the Women in Maritime East and Southern Africa (WOMESA) –Kenya Chapter.


Passionate about female participation in the maritime world, Mwanaulu has been a convenor/moderator and speaker in forums including World Maritime Day, IMO – International Day for Women in Maritime, the 6th Assembly of the Association of African Maritime Administrations (AAMA) and the United Nations 4th Oceans Forums.
